Form 4: Exagen Inc. CFO, Jeffrey G. Black, Reports Stock Transactions

Sentiment:

SEC Form 4 Filing


Exagen Inc.'s Chief Financial Officer, Jeffrey G. Black, acquired 22,298 shares of common stock at an average price of $2.98 on November 15, 2024.

Summary

  • Jeffrey G. Black, the Chief Financial Officer of Exagen Inc., reported a transaction involving the company's common stock.
  • On November 15, 2024, Mr. Black acquired 22,298 shares of common stock.
  • The shares were purchased at a weighted average price of $2.98 per share.
  • The price range for the transactions was between $2.84 and $3.25 per share.
  • Following this transaction, Mr. Black directly owns 274,492 shares of Exagen Inc. common stock.
